WebPCR (Polymerase Chain Reaction) in general is a process of copying or amplifying the DNA or, in the case of COVID-19, the RNA for use in diagnosis. Just like cells in our bodies can copy their nucleic acid, we can also replicate DNA and RNA in the laboratory using specialized instruments. This replication allows us to make several billion ...
